Do you have any tips for my flight to Keaton Beach?
If you're poorly prepared, airports and flying can be testing. But there's no need to worry. Follow these helpful hints for a stress-free start to your holiday in Keaton Beach. What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• Flying can be a pleasure if you carry the right things. First of all you'll need basic toiletries, such as toothpaste, a toothbrush and some deodorant, a clean set of clothes and a good novel. Next, find room in your carry-on bag for your mobile phone, a charger, any medications and perhaps a proper neck pillow as well. Lastly, and most importantly, be sure to take your passport, travel docs and some money.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Make sure you don't have sharp objects (like a pocket knife) lurking in one of the zippers of your carry-on luggage. Other banned items include explosive or flammable substances, such as aerosol cans and bleach, and liquids and gels in containers with a capacity of more than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your aim is to feel as comfortable as possible. Opt for slip-on footwear, dress in loose, breathable clothing and don't forget to bring a sweater in case it gets chilly in the cabin.
  • Caused by sustained peri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clot condition that can affect some passengers during long-haul flights. Lower your risks by drinking water, keeping your lower limbs moving and wearing compression socks to help your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Keaton Beach?
The answer is simple — be organised. We've put together some useful tips for a hassle-free trip through airport security. Watch out Keaton Beach, here you come:

  • Airport security personnel first need to determine that you have a valid ID and boarding pass before you can proceed any further. Have them ready for inspection.
  • The X-ray machine comes next. Empty your pockets and remove anything metal that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es items like earphones or headphones, as well as bulky coats or jackets.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• Your electronic devices like laptops and phones will also have to go through the machine to be scanned. Don't worry though, you'll be back online before you know it.
  • Travelling with a new hand cream? No problem. As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a zip-lock bag, you can bring it with you in your carry-on bag.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you several precious minutes. Hiking boots are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Lightweight sneakers usually aren't.
  • Sharp items can't be taken on board. They'll be confiscated at security, so pack them in your checked luggage.
